Monolithic Fortresses of Resilience

Monolithic construction is key to precast concrete’s strength. The tanks aren’t fabricated in parts, but are made as a single structure. The top-quality concrete, bolstered by steel reinforcements, creates an enduring fortress that can withstand the challenges posed by New Hampshire’s shifting soil conditions and the harsh winters. Even the most tenacious tree roots are no match for the robust construction of a precast concrete septic tank.

No Cracks, No Leaks, No Worries

The fear of leaks as well as cracks haunting traditional septic tanks is a thing of the past with precast concrete. The homogeneity and absence seams in the concrete ensures an impenetrable, tight seal. This protects against leaks, and eliminates concerns over contamination of the groundwater.

The Ally of Gravity is

The massive concrete construction of precast septic tanks makes them resistant to buoyant forces. Contrary to their plastic counterparts precast tanks do not pop out of the ground unexpectedly. This gravity-driven stability eliminates the need for elaborate anchoring systems which allows them to remain firmly in place without the constantly worrying about shifting soil.
